"I have not received any instruction from the executive power" in the Fillon case, said Catherine Champrenault on Thursday. She was questioned by the Parliamentary Commission of Inquiry on the Independence of Justice after remarks by the ex-head of the national financial parquet Eliane Houlette which raised accusations of “instrumentalisation” of justice.

"I have not received in the Fillon case as in all other files under my hierarchical control no instruction from the Directorate of Criminal Affairs and Pardons (DACG), no instruction from the executive power and (…) I have not never relayed a request from the Keeper of the Seals or the executive to influence a procedure, ”said Catherine Champrenault.
